Stephen F. Austin State University's Richard and Lucille ÌÇÐÄvlog´«Ã½ of Nursing has earned the prestigious "Center of Educational Excellence" designation from the Laerdal Medical Corporation.
The designation is awarded to educational centers that have consistently demonstrated excellence in educational philosophy and programs for the purposes of "helping save lives," the company's motto. The ÌÇÐÄvlog´«Ã½ of Nursing is one of only 15 centers in the nation to receive the award.

ÌÇÐÄvlog´«Ã½ to screen 'Art and Copy'
NACOGDOCHES, TEXAS - Advertising slogans such as "Just Do It," "I Love NY," "Where's the Beef?" and "got milk?" are explored in Doug Pray's documentary "Art & Copy," which the Stephen F. Austin State University School of Art will present at 7 p.m. Friday, Feb. 5, at The Cole Art Center @ The Old Opera House.
The free, one-night screening is a part of the monthly film series sponsored in part by the ÌÇÐÄvlog´«Ã½ Friends of the Visual Arts. The Ad Design program at ÌÇÐÄvlog´«Ã½ is also sponsoring this screening.

ÌÇÐÄvlog´«Ã½ Board of Regents approves new admission standards
Stephen F. Austin State University will increase its admission standards for first-time freshmen beginning with the fall 2012 semester.
The ÌÇÐÄvlog´«Ã½ Board of Regents approved the change at a Monday board meeting based on a recommendation from the university's administration. Raising freshman admission standards is one of the goals included in ÌÇÐÄvlog´«Ã½'s comprehensive five-year strategic plan.
